Muskoka Airport (IATA: YQA, ICAO: CYQA) is a small regional airport located 4 nautical miles (7.4 km; 4.6 mi) south of Bracebridge, Ontario, Canada. The airport is classified as an airport of entry by Nav Canada and is staffed by the Canada Border Services Agency (CBSA) on a call-out basis. CBSA officers at this airport can handle general aviation aircraft only, with no more than 15 passengers.[1]
